Cabin Fan control on the fritz ...
#1
Hi All
I am the owner of a beloved 1.9D (03) with c. 140,00 on the clock.

Current issue is that fan control on the central cabin console seems to be pretty u/s in that the fan is more or less on all the time (to the max) but with ability to tweak it down slightly.
The traction on the dial action does seem to be less +ve of late and I am thinking I have a wear issue with the mechanism which is giving me the always on effect .....

I have had (and fixed ) the blower motor resistor/pcb at 100k and I think this is different...

Anyone got a clue or seen (fixed) this before ??
